Sleep, Memory and Age

UC Berkeley neuroscientists have found a connection between poor sleep, memory loss and aging. They conducted a study that slow brain waves generated during the deep sleep plays a role and how much we are able to store in memory.  Their discovery opens doors to boosting the quality of sleep in elderly people to improve memory.

Surviving Spouses Group

Verna Rose Kelsey was married to a 25 year veteran of the Oakland Police Department. After 36 years of marriage, her husband died from ALS.  Kelsey went into a deep depression but soon realized that she wasn’t the only widow that needed grief support. In 2007, with the support of the Oakland Police Department, Kelsey founded the Surviving Spouses Group.

The Great Bay Area Service Day for Schools

St. Mary’s College, KTVU and TV36 has joined together in volunteering to help spruce up 22 Bay Area schools. On Saturday, March 16th,  lot of elbow grease will be used to help schools with general landscaping needs such as weeding, mulching and planting trees and flowers. Painting benches and playground  blacktops and helping out in classrooms are also on day’s agenda.   Through St. Mary’s CILSA program, this one day of service will have hundreds of volunteers fan out to schools in 6 counties: Marin , Contra Costa County, San Francisco, Alameda and San Mateo.
